Impact of Biodegradable Materials on Coffee Industry's Carbon Footprint Reduction

You know, the coffee world is really starting to wake up to how important sustainability is. More and more, companies are turning to eco-friendly stuff, like biodegradable paper cups for machines—it's pretty cool. I read in a report from the World Economic Forum that the coffee industry pumps out around 1.2 billion tons of CO2 every year. Crazy, right? But here’s the good news—by switching to biodegradable materials, those cups can really help cut down on the carbon footprint. For example, studies say that these eco-friendly cups break down completely within about 90 days in commercial composting facilities, which is a huge contrast to regular plastic cups that can take up to a thousand years to decompose in landfills. Evaluating the Lifecycle Assessment of Machine Cup Paper vs. Traditional Coffee Cups

You know, when you compare the full lifecycle of machine cup paper to those old-school traditional coffee cups, it’s pretty clear that machine cup paper has some serious environmental perks. Those regular coffee cups, especially the ones coated in plastic, are a nightmare to recycle and often end up clogging up landfills. On the flip side, machine cup paper is intentionally made to be easier to recycle or even compost, which means it’s way better for our planet. When you think about everything from how it’s made, to how we use it, and what happens after—machine cup paper generally leaves a smaller carbon footprint. That makes it a smarter choice for coffee fans who care about sustainability.
